What are shareable links in ChatGPT?
Shareable Links is a new feature that allows users to turkey number dataset create a unique URL for a ChatGPT conversation that can then be shared with friends, colleagues, and collaborators. This provides a new way to share ChatGPT conversations, replacing the old and tedious method of sharing screenshots.
Shareable links allow you to let others see – and even continue – interesting, funny or insightful conversations with ChatGPT . This even works if you have used ChatGPT plugins . These will be displayed accordingly.
Where can I find shareable links?
Shareable links are being rolled out to users gradually. They are currently only available on the chat.openai.com website and not yet in the iOS app. But don't worry, iOS support is in the works and coming soon!

How do I create a shareable link?
To create a shareable link, simply hover over a chat and click the share link. You'll then be able to see a preview of the conversation snapshot you're about to send. You'll then have the option to share the link with your name or anonymously by clicking the three dots.

If you want to update the link after it's created, you can open the share modal for that conversation and click on the three dots with options to update the name visibility (share your name or make it anonymous). There you can also delete the link if necessary. To save, you need to click on the green button that says "Update and Copy Link".
Who can access shared links?
Anyone who has access to a shareable link can view and continue the linked conversation. Of course, sensitive content should not be shared, as anyone with the link can access the conversation or share the link with other people.

If you've created a link that you no longer want to be public, you can delete the link or delete the conversation. The conversation will no longer be accessible via the shared link, but if a user has imported the conversation into their chat history, deleting your link will not remove the conversation from their chat history.
